Window Refurbishment: A Comprehensive Guide
Window refurbishment is an important aspect of home maintenance and improvement that not only boosts the visual appeal of a property however also increases energy efficiency. Gradually, windows can end up being victims of wear and tear due to ecological elements, leading to issues like drafts, leakages, and decreased insulation. This post explores the benefits, processes, and factors involved in window refurbishment, providing house owners with a thorough understanding of what's needed.
What is Window Refurbishment?
Window Emergency Service refurbishment involves the restoration, repair, or upgrading of existing windows. Unlike window replacement, which entails removing old windows completely and setting up new ones, refurbishment focuses on keeping the original frames and glass, often resulting in considerable expense savings while protecting the character of a structure.
Benefits of Window Refurbishment
Before diving into the refurbishment procedure, let's look at a few of the key advantages:
- Cost-Effective: Refurbishing existing windows is normally less expensive than total replacement.
- Conservation of Architectural Character: Maintaining original windows assists to preserve the property's historic and architectural stability.
- Enhanced Energy Efficiency: Modern techniques can improve insulation and reduce heating costs.
- Minimized Waste: Refurbishment lessens ecological effect by lowering landfill waste from old windows.
- Enhanced Comfort: Properly refurbished windows can get rid of drafts, improving indoor comfort levels.
The Window Refurbishment Process
Window refurbishment generally occurs in a number of stages, as described listed below:
Assessment and Inspection:
- Condition Analysis: Inspect windows for rot, cracks, or structural problems.
- Energy Efficiency Check: Evaluate insulation and sealing effectiveness.
Cleaning and Preparation:
- Surface Cleaning: Remove dirt, paint, and old sealant.
- Repair Work: Address any structural damage, such as rot or decay.
Upgrading Components:
- Sealing Gaps: Improve weatherization by applying new seals or caulk.
- Glass Replacement: Upgrade to double or triple glazing for much better insulation.
Completing Touches:
- Painting and Staining: Restore or alter the exterior surface for security and aesthetic appeals.
- Hardware Replacement: Update locks, manages, and hinges for enhanced functionality.
Final Inspection:
- Ensure all reconditioned elements are operating properly and efficiently.

Regularly Asked Questions (FAQs)
1. How long does window refurbishment take?
The period can vary depending upon the number of windows and the degree of the work needed. Usually, it can take anywhere from a few days to numerous weeks.
2. Can all types of windows be reconditioned?
Most window types can be refurbished, consisting of wood, aluminum, and vinyl windows. However, the approaches may differ.
3. Is refurbishment environmentally friendly?
Yes, refurbishing windows is a sustainable practice as it minimizes waste and saves resources by extending the life-span of existing materials.
4. How can I tell if my windows require refurbishment?
Indications consist of draftiness, condensation in between the panes, peeling paint, and noticeable damage like rot or fractures.
5. Should I try refurbishment myself?
While small repairs can be carried out by property owners, it's often best to hire professionals for substantial work or if you lack experience, especially with structural changes.
When to Consider Replacement Over Refurbishment
In some instances, window replacement might be more appropriate than refurbishment. Consider replacement if:
- The windows are badly harmed beyond repair.
- The expense of refurbishment approaches the cost of new windows.
- You prefer an extreme change in window design for aesthetic factors.
- Energy performance is considerably jeopardized, and modern replacements might offer much better solutions.
